FumoniTest WB is a quantitative LC method that uses wide bore immunoaffinity columns for the detection of fumonisin mycotoxins B1, B2 and B3 in a variety of commodities. With a total volume of 3 mL, FumoniTest WB allows for a faster flow rate preferred by many laboratories and is the ideal cleanup step for any LC.

Background
Fumonisins are mycotoxins produced by the fungus Fusarium moniliforme. F. moniliforme is a frequent, almost universal, inhabitant of corn. Fumonisin B1, B2 and B3 are present in most corn samples tested, often totaling greater than 1 ppm. Fumonisin is thought to cause equine leukoencephalomalacia in horses, swine pulmonary edema, and human esophageal cancer. The FDA/USDA Working Group on Fumonisin advises less than 4 ppm for products for human consumption, less than 5 mg/kg in horse feed, less than 10 mg/kg for swine feed, and less than 50 mg/kg for cattle feed.
